George Russell witnessed Lando Norris facing Max Verstappen shortly before a major incident at the Austrian Grand Prix.

George Russell revealed that he witnessed a fierce battle between Max Verstappen and Lando Norris during the Austrian Grand Prix. The race was undoubtedly one of the most exciting of the 2024 Formula 1 season. Just when it seemed like Verstappen was on his way to another victory, disaster struck when he collided with Norris. Russell emerged as the lucky winner of the race and acknowledged that he saw the intense competition unfold firsthand.

Russell expressed his surprise at winning the race. The British driver admitted that it was a challenging competition as he continued to face Verstappen and Norris. At the time of the incident between the race leaders, Russell was only a few seconds ahead of second-place Piastri.

During the race, Russell revealed that he was watching the battle between Verstappen and Norris on the big screens. He witnessed Norris attempting a late overtake for the lead, which ultimately resulted in a major incident up front. However, Russell praised Mercedes for capitalizing on the situation and securing their first victory since 2022.

Max Verstappen had established a comfortable lead over Norris with just over 10 laps remaining. However, a late pit stop allowed Norris to close the gap to just two seconds behind the Dutch driver. Eventually, the two engaged in a fierce battle for the lead, with Russell trailing about 12 seconds behind in third place.

Russell admitted that he was surprised to find himself so far behind the race leaders before the incident occurred. He stated that he always expects something to happen up front, giving him the opportunity to fight for the win. That wish came true for George Russell in his second Formula 1 career victory at the Austrian Grand Prix.

Russell and Mercedes are excited to end the winning drought in Formula 1. However, it is evident that the Silver Arrows do not have the pace to be true contenders for victories. Therefore, George Russell and his team will be seeking to make further improvements in the upcoming races.
